Real Time X-Ray images are stored on CD ROM/XA. Compared to film the volume for a storage is reduced by a factor 50. Retrieving is easy since information of the location is given in the directory of the diskette. Normally the directory name is the shop order and the file name is the serial number of the part. The directory and file names can be customised. [Pg.457]

The Colourindex (5) assigns Cl generic names to commercial dyes. This Cl name is defined as "a classification name and serial number which when allocated to a commercial product allows that product to be uniquely identified within any Colourindex AppHcation Class." This enables the particular commercial products to be classified along with other products whose essential colorant has the same chemical constitution. [Pg.378]

In most places, the available information about any pump, such as the manufacturer, year of purehase, model and serial number is plaeed in a file for general aeeounting purposes. In other plants, such as a manufaeturer, the model, lubricant and lubrication frequency is placed in a lubrication schedule. In either case, additional key information ean be stored with a little more effort. [Pg.226]

An adequately documented requirement would be a written contract, schedule of work, and/or specification. However simple the requirement, it is wise to have it documented in case of a dispute later. The document needs to carry an identity and if subject to change, an issue status. In the simple case this is the serial numbered invoice and in more complicated transactions, it will be a multi-page contract with official contract number, date, and signatures of both parties. [Pg.226]

The standard does not address product recall other than in the context of releasing product for urgent production purposes in clause 4.10.2.3. The reported nonconformities from your customers may be so severe that you need to recall product, not just one or two but a whole batch or several batches between two dates or serial numbers. Product recall can be considered to fall within the scope of handling reported nonconformities ... [Pg.455]

Records can take various forms reports containing narrative, computer data, forms containing data in boxes, graphs, tables, lists, and many others. Where forms are used to collect data, they should carry a form number and name as their identification. When completed they should carry a serial number to give each a separate identity. Records should also be traceable to the product or service they represent and this can be achieved either within the reference number or separately, providing the chance of mistaken identity is eliminated. The standard does not require records to be identifiable to the product involved but unless you do make such provision you will not be able to access the pertinent records or demonstrate conformance to specified requirements. [Pg.495]
